Output 300f7118a9615ba5de1ca1a7e03ad8b19a138588cf9794117b28cbf5478aaf79:0

value
477711
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12b3f2246a68e24d755a5b597e21f3b76aa9d8d5 OP_EQUAL
address
33PuerXqWtwFYq1BZYquyjKw31MBCY2uEa
transaction
300f7118a9615ba5de1ca1a7e03ad8b19a138588cf9794117b28cbf5478aaf79
spent
true